Top 5 Best Pike County Public Middle Schools (2024)

For the 2024 school year, there are 6 public middle schools serving 1,229 students in Pike County, MS.
The top ranked public middle schools in Pike County, MS are North Pike Middle School, Denman Junior High School and South Pike Jr High School. Overall testing rank is based on a school's combined math and reading proficiency test score ranking.
Pike County, MS public middle schools have an average math proficiency score of 19% (versus the Mississippi public middle school average of 36%), and reading proficiency score of 20% (versus the 33% statewide average). Middle schools in Pike County have an average ranking of 4/10, which is in the bottom 50% of Mississippi public middle schools.
Minority enrollment is 72% of the student body (majority Black), which is more than the Mississippi public middle school average of 52% (majority Black).
